TELL ME ABOUT THE BEGINNINGS OF TRANSCENDENCE THEATER.
It's a very exciting story about having a dream and going after it.  I had a vision... I think the year was about 2008.  I had a great career in dancing, and doing musical theater, television and commercials. But I really was searching for a stronger way to use my art and move a community. So I had an idea and a vision for a theater company. One that was going to specialize in musicals in an outdoor setting and also one that was gonna create a healthy company culture for artists to be a part of. So I had this vision. I actually put it on a videotape and I shared it with five of my closest friends. Everyone was like "This is amazing. It's like twenty years to build and ten years to find."


I told the townspeople about it and they actually gave us the space for free which started our company in 2009 with a four month community service project and  health project in Mexico and from there we went on a cross country research tour looking for a location where we wanted o build our company in. We settled in Sonoma California and then it took about nine months to a year of doing research in that area.

I found that many of outdoor theaters actually started in state parks. Which started us looking into state parks. We found that 70 of them was on the closure list due to California State budget cut. So we hopped on a car, my fellow producers and I, to find land for our theater. Jack London State Park was the perfect location for us to build this company so we spoke with the people involved in the park system telling them an innovative idea that can help bring more people into the park and give them incredible experiences in it. We produced a concert last October that was completely sold out. We just got our contract to produce a summer season and here I am now just relocated from Los Angeles to Sonoma to bring this dream to life. It's just been an incredible kind of serendipitous and synchronistic journey that continues  to grow. That's how Transcendence Theater came into being.

TELL ME MORE ABOUT THE TURNING POINT.
Well, I have been dieting for 10 years and the whole time I was dieting I was gaining weight. Maybe I'd lose 10 lbs, and gain 20 lbs over and over again until I gained over 200 lbs. I tried everything. I worked face to face with the late Dr. Atkins and the end all he could do was yell at me for being so fat. I went to the Pritikin Institute, I had fitness trainers, I had naturopaths and used herb medicines, had acupuncture and traditional medicine and it would always follow the same pattern: I lose all the weight, I gain all the weight. I finally got to a place where I decided I was never gonna diet again and rather than diet I was going to try to understand what my body wanted me fat in the first place, and that's when everything changed, where my focus changed from trying to force myself to lose weight to understanding what my body was the way it was. I went on a quest in every different direction. I studied Biochemistry, Neurobiology, Stress Management, Consciousness, Meditation, Thought Field Therapy, the relationship between the mind and body, and also how to nourish my body better. Slowly, by making the focus about what my body needs, why it needs fat, and how to get it to no longer have that need and to satisfy it some other way, I then started to lose weight.

The hard part was really that point when I was on my knees, in desperation and saying "I give up. I'm never gonna diet again. I'm not gonna go down this road ever again" This road of willpower and forcing my body and good days and bad days...It's like your whole life is a battle against what your body wants you to eat and what you're trying to eat. I let all that go. I stopped having good days and bad days. I ate what I wanted but I kept the focus on understanding why my body wanted to be fat. That was a huge paradigm shift for me and once that happened the weight went down automatically.

THAT'S WONDERFUL. WHEN YOU GOT DOWN TO YOUR DESIRED WEIGHT, HOW WAS THE MAINTENANCE LIKE? HOW DID YOU KEEP YOURSELF DISCIPLINED AND KEEP WEIGHT OFF FOR A PROLONGED PERIOD?
It's a very organic process. I wouldn't consider it a discipline at all. The reason why you gain your weight back on a diet is because you haven't addressed the real issue, and the real issue is a very subtle thing. Real issues could be physical, mental or emotional. For many people it's emotional. There are some of us (and I had this) who have an emotional need to have weight, not to eat but to have weight on our body to feel safe. Weight is all about safety. When you understand that you have to ask yourself : "In what way does my body feel safer having the weight?" and it could be because you're not nourishing your body properly so you're in a kind of famine or it could be because you're chronically dieting, and when you diet you artificially induce a famine and the whole reason we have weight is to protect us against famine. Because you've artificially induced the famine you're gonna get your body to want to hold on to the weight to protect you against famine so you end up going to war with your body, and then it's always a struggle.

So, you talk about things like maintenance and discipline and struggle. That's an old paradigm that doesn't work. If you keep the focus on "Why does my body need the weight as a form of safety?" : Is it an emotional tool? Is it a mental tool? Is it a chemical or physical tool? Is it because I'm taking medication or artificial ingredients or my digestion is wrong or I may have sleep apnea or I'm dehydrated or I've got this emotional need for it? Do I need energetic grounding or do I have too much stress and the stress is elevating my fat program chemicals? -- What is the real reason that your body is using weight? You've got to address that and when you do there is no maintenance. There's no 'program'... You've solved the issue. You've got to get to the core issue and the core issue is always about safety. Your body uses weight as a form of safety. If your body doesn't feel like it needs the protection anymore the weight falls off. No maintenance, no schedule, no discipline. You become once again a naturally thin person. You eat what you want. You don't eat too much because you're not that hungry , because your body doesn't want the weight anymore. My focus is all about how to solve the problem.
